TP conversations can be locally initiated (initiated by the
TP on the HP 3000), or remotely initiated (initiated by
the TP on the remote system). This section describes the tasks that
the local application programmer, the node manager, and the remote
application programmer must perform in order to establish a locally
or remotely initiated conversation. Locally Initiated Conversations |  |
The following things must occur for a local TP to initiate
a conversation: An APPC session of the appropriate
session type must be established. A local end user must run the local TP. The local TP must send an allocate request over
the session assigned to it, to request a conversation with the remote
TP. The remote TP must be coded to receive the allocate
request from the local TP.
Note that the session must be established before the local
TP can use it to send the allocate request. This section describes
the tasks that the local application programmer and the node manager
must perform in order to establish a locally initiated conversation. To prepare for a locally initiated conversation, you must
do the following: Work with the programmer on the remote
system to design and code the TP. Ask the node manager for the name of an appropriately
configured session type, or ask the node manager to configure a
session type for the conversation. The session type must direct
data to the remote LU that serves the remote TP. Code the name of the session type into the SessionType parameter of the MCAllocate intrinsic.
To prepare for a locally initiated conversation, the node
manager must do the following: Configure an appropriate session type.
For information on configuring session types, see the APPC
Subsystem on MPE XL Node Manager's Guide or
the LU 6.2 API/V Node Manager's
Guide. Tell the application programmer the name of the
session type. The programmer must code the name of the session type
into the local TP. Activate a session of the appropriate session type,
or configure one for automatic activation at subsystem startup.
For more information on session activation, see the APPC
Subsystem on MPE XL Node Manager's Guide or
the APPC Subsystem on MPE V Node Manager's Guide.
Remotely Initiated Conversations on MPE V |  |
The following things must occur for a remote TP to initiate
a conversation on MPE V: An APPC session of the appropriate
session type must be established. The remote TP must issue an allocate request over
that session, specifying the name of the job that runs the local
TP with which it wants a conversation. The APPC subsystem must receive the allocate request
and stream the job that runs the local TP. The local TP must be coded to receive the allocate
request from the remote TP.
To prepare for remotely initiated conversations, you must
do the following: Work with the programmer on the remote
system to design and code the TP. The local TP must call the
MCGetAllocate intrinsic to receive an allocate request from
the remote TP. Ask the node manager for the name of an appropriately
configured session type, or ask the node manager to configure a
session type for the conversation. The session type must direct
data to the remote LU that serves the remote TP. Code the name of the session type into the SessionType parameter of the MCGetAllocate intrinsic. Tell the node manager the executable file name of
the TP. The executable file may reside in any group and account.
The node manager will create a job to run the TP. Ask the node manager for the name of the job file
that runs the local TP, and tell the programmer on the remote system
what the job file name is. The remote system must send the name
of the job file in the allocate request.
To prepare for a remotely initiated conversation on MPE V,
the node manager must do the following: Configure an appropriate session type.
See the LU 6.2 API/V Node Manager's Guide for
information on session type configuration. Tell the application programmer the name of the
session type. The programmer must code the name of the session type
into the local TP. Activate a session of the appropriate session type,
or configure one for automatic activation at subsystem startup. Create a job that runs the executable TP file. The
job file must be located in the APPC.SYS group and account. See
the LU 6.2 API/V Node Manager's
Guide for more information.
To prepare a remote program to initiate a conversation with
an HP TP on MPE V, the remote programmer must do the following: Design and code the program to initiate
a conversation with the corresponding TP on the HP 3000. Make sure that the remote TP passes the proper job
name in the allocate request. The HP application programmer must
tell the remote TP programmer which job name to use.
Remotely Initiated Conversations on MPE XL |  |
The following things must occur for a remote TP to initiate
a conversation with a local TP on MPE XL: An APPC session of the appropriate
session type must be established. The remote TP must issue an allocate request over
that session, specifying the name of the local TP with which it
wants a conversation. The APPC subsystem must receive the allocate request,
look up the local TP name in the APPC subsystem configuration file,
and determine from the configuration file what to do with the allocate request. If the local TP is configured
to conduct multiple remotely initiated conversations, and if it
is already active and in conversation, the APPC subsystem must queue
the allocate request until the local TP finishes the current conversation
and calls the MCGetAllocate intrinsic again. If the local TP is not currently running,
the APPC subsystem must stream the job that runs the local TP
. If the local TP is configured to conduct only one
remotely initiated conversation, the APPC subsystem must stream
the job that runs the local TP.
The local TP must be coded to receive the allocate
request from the remote TP.
 |  |  |  |  | NOTE: On MPE XL, any local TPs that will conduct remotely
initiated conversations must be configured through NMMGR/XL. See
the APPC Subsystem on MPE XL Node Manager's
Guide for information on TP configuration. |  |  |  |  |
To prepare for remotely initiated conversations on MPE XL,
you must do the following: Work with the programmer on the remote
system to design and code the TP. The local TP can be designed to
receive multiple allocate requests from the remote TP, or it can
be designed to receive only one allocate request. A TP designed
to receive multiple allocate requests must call the MCGetAllocate intrinsic multiple times. A TP designed to receive
only one allocate request must call the MCGetAllocate intrinsic only once. Together with the programmer on the remote system,
decide on a name for the TP. Make sure you and the other programmer
agree on the TP name; it must be coded into the local TP, and it
must be sent by the remote system in the allocate request. Tell
the node manager the TP name. The node manager must configure the
TP name in the APPC subsystem configuration file. Code the TP name into the LocalTPName parameter of the MCGetAllocate intrinsic and the LocalTPName parameter of the TPStarted intrinsic. Ask the node manager for the name of an appropriately
configured session type, or ask the node manager to configure a
session type for the conversation. The session type must direct
data to the remote LU that serves the remote TP. Code the name of the session type into the SessionType parameter of the MCGetAllocate intrinsic. Tell the node manager the executable file name of
the TP. The executable file may reside in any group and account.
The node manager will create a job to run the TP. Tell the node manager whether the TP calls the
MCGetAllocate intrinsic multiple times or only once. The node
manager must configure the TP to accept either single or queued
allocate requests. Decide whether you want to start the TP yourself
or have the APPC subsystem start the TP. While you are debugging
the TP, you might want to start it yourself. However, once the TP
is working, you should have the APPC subsystem start the TP when
it receives an allocate request from the remote TP. Tell the node
manager whether to configure the TP for manual or automatic startup. Tell the node manager how long the local TP should
wait for an allocate request from the remote TP before the
MCGetAllocate intrinsic times out. The node manager will configure
the time-out value.
To prepare for a remotely initiated conversation on MPE XL,
the node manager must do the following: Configure an appropriate session type. Tell the application programmer the name of the
session type. The programmer must code the name of the session type
into the local TP. Activate a session of the appropriate session type,
or configure one for automatic activation at subsystem startup. Create a job that runs the executable TP file. See
the APPC Subsystem on MPE XL Node Manager's
Guide for more information. Configure the TP name, the job name, the time-out
value, whether the TP accepts queued allocate requests, and whether
the programmer will start the TP manually. See the APPC
Subsystem on MPE XL Node Manager's Guide for
information on TP configuration.
To prepare a remote program to initiate a conversation with
an HP TP on MPE XL, the remote programmer must do the following: Design and code the program to initiate
a conversation with the corresponding TP on the HP 3000. Make sure that the remote TP passes the proper TP
name in the allocate request. The HP application programmer must
tell the remote TP programmer which TP name to use.
